doc: Refresh more URLs in the docs
authorMichael Paquier
Sat, 18 Jul 2020 13:43:53 +0000 (22:43 +0900)
committerMichael Paquier
Sat, 18 Jul 2020 13:43:53 +0000 (22:43 +0900)
This updates some URLs that are redirections, mostly to an equivalent
using https.  One URL referring to generalized partial indexes was
outdated.

Author: Kyotaro Horiguchi
Discussion: https://postgr.es/m/20200717.121308.1369606287593685396[email protected]
Backpatch-through: 9.5

18 files changed:
doc/src/sgml/acronyms.sgml
doc/src/sgml/biblio.sgml
doc/src/sgml/config.sgml
doc/src/sgml/cube.sgml
doc/src/sgml/dfunc.sgml
doc/src/sgml/earthdistance.sgml
doc/src/sgml/external-projects.sgml
doc/src/sgml/geqo.sgml
doc/src/sgml/install-windows.sgml
doc/src/sgml/intro.sgml
doc/src/sgml/isn.sgml
doc/src/sgml/monitoring.sgml
doc/src/sgml/nls.sgml
doc/src/sgml/pgcrypto.sgml
doc/src/sgml/plperl.sgml
doc/src/sgml/pltcl.sgml
doc/src/sgml/seg.sgml
doc/src/sgml/textsearch.sgml

index 85db4b3cf8f29447296769ba799cf9095f902df0..6d9c51b5e68469799fe66c3a5dce0ba666c4ecae 100644 (file)
     CVE
     
      
-      Common Vulnerabilities and Exposures
+      s://cve.mitre.org/">Common Vulnerabilities and Exposures
      
     
    
     IEEE
     
      
-      Institute of Electrical and
+      s://standards.ieee.org/">Institute of Electrical and
       Electronics Engineers
      
     
index 2bc886688493d30ed6f59181979046634c6fa449..5e08adf0e5635f4b4da32d935bf9c40c9fab3c38 100644 (file)
@@ -12,7 +12,7 @@
    Some white papers and technical reports from the original
    POSTGRES development team
    are available at the University of California, Berkeley, Computer Science
-   Department ://db.cs.berkeley.edu/papers/">web site.
+   Department s://dsf.berkeley.edu/papers/">web site.
   
 
   
    
 
   
-   <ulink url="http<span class="marked">://db.cs</span>.berkeley.edu/papers/UCB-MS-zfong.pdf">The</div> <div class="diff add">+   <title><ulink url="http<span class="marked">s://dsf</span>.berkeley.edu/papers/UCB-MS-zfong.pdf">The</div> <div class="diff ctx">    design and implementation of the <productname>POSTGRES</productname> query</div> <div class="diff ctx">    optimizer</ulink>
    
 
    
    
-    <ulink url="http<span class="marked">://db.cs</span>.berkeley.edu/papers/ERL-M87-13.pdf">The <productname>POSTGRES</productname></div> <div class="diff add">+    <title><ulink url="http<span class="marked">s://dsf</span>.berkeley.edu/papers/ERL-M87-13.pdf">The <productname>POSTGRES</productname></div> <div class="diff ctx">     data model</ulink>
     
      
 
    
    
-    <ulink url="http<span class="marked">://citeseer.ist.psu.edu/seshadri95generalized.html</span>">Generalized</div> <div class="diff add">+    <title><ulink url="http<span class="marked">s://citeseer.ist.psu.edu/viewdoc/summary?doi=10.1.1.40.5740</span>">Generalized</div> <div class="diff ctx">     Partial Indexes</ulink>
     
      
 
    
    
-    <ulink url="http<span class="marked">://db.cs</span>.berkeley.edu/papers/ERL-M85-95.pdf">The</div> <div class="diff add">+    <title><ulink url="http<span class="marked">s://dsf</span>.berkeley.edu/papers/ERL-M85-95.pdf">The</div> <div class="diff ctx">     design of <productname>POSTGRES</productname></ulink>
     
      
 
    
    
-    <ulink url="http<span class="marked">://db.cs</span>.berkeley.edu/papers/ERL-M87-06.pdf">The</div> <div class="diff add">+    <title><ulink url="http<span class="marked">s://dsf</span>.berkeley.edu/papers/ERL-M87-06.pdf">The</div> <div class="diff ctx">     design of the <productname>POSTGRES</productname> storage</div> <div class="diff ctx">     system</ulink>
     
 
    
    
-    <ulink url="http<span class="marked">://db.cs</span>.berkeley.edu/papers/ERL-M89-82.pdf">A</div> <div class="diff add">+    <title><ulink url="http<span class="marked">s://dsf</span>.berkeley.edu/papers/ERL-M89-82.pdf">A</div> <div class="diff ctx">     commentary on the <productname>POSTGRES</productname> rules</div> <div class="diff ctx">     system</ulink>
     
 
    
    
-    <ulink url="http<span class="marked">://db.cs</span>.berkeley.edu/papers/ERL-M89-17.pdf">The</div> <div class="diff add">+    <title><ulink url="http<span class="marked">s://dsf</span>.berkeley.edu/papers/ERL-M89-17.pdf">The</div> <div class="diff ctx">     case for partial indexes</ulink>
     
      
 
    
    
-    <ulink url="http<span class="marked">://db.cs</span>.berkeley.edu/papers/ERL-M90-34.pdf">The</div> <div class="diff add">+    <title><ulink url="http<span class="marked">s://dsf</span>.berkeley.edu/papers/ERL-M90-34.pdf">The</div> <div class="diff ctx">     implementation of <productname>POSTGRES</productname></ulink>
     
      
 
    
    
-    <ulink url="http<span class="marked">://db.cs</span>.berkeley.edu/papers/ERL-M90-36.pdf">On</div> <div class="diff add">+    <title><ulink url="http<span class="marked">s://dsf</span>.berkeley.edu/papers/ERL-M90-36.pdf">On</div> <div class="diff ctx">     Rules, Procedures, Caching and Views in Database Systems</ulink>
     
      
index 179cd96cbec02800ae24905c5bf259e5df104702..4fe11cdf1594b7f249a8f51f171a39dc85f5da51 100644 (file)
@@ -4541,7 +4541,7 @@ local0.*    /var/log/postgresql
         by .)
         The supported %-escapes are similar to those
         listed in the Open Group's 
-        url="http://pubs.opengroup.org/onlinepubs/009695399/functions/strftime.html">strftime
+        url="https://pubs.opengroup.org/onlinepubs/009695399/functions/strftime.html">strftime
          specification.
         Note that the system's strftime is not used
         directly, so platform-specific (nonstandard) extensions do not work.
index 3d503719c59c775f7d3986c5c0fd66a60f329d87..8201cc2f9f8ce7734a6263cda98e718f95fd6d24 100644 (file)
@@ -544,7 +544,7 @@ t
 
   
    My thanks are primarily to Prof. Joe Hellerstein
-   (://db.cs.berkeley.edu/jmh/">) for elucidating the
+   (s://dsf.berkeley.edu/jmh/">) for elucidating the
    gist of the GiST (), and
    to his former student Andy Dong for his example written for Illustra.
    I am also grateful to all Postgres developers, present and past, for
index 23af270e32c3481ea85fa8f1e7e85836eb107111..1081cb6fb3ec68915e51e3c4113f5926c2bfa3be 100644 (file)
@@ -208,7 +208,7 @@ gcc -G -o foo.so foo.o
  
   
    If this is too complicated for you, you should consider using
-   
+   s://www.gnu.org/software/libtool/">
    GNU Libtool,
    which hides the platform differences behind a uniform interface.
   
index 6dedc4a5f49931bec95e430cbeeb6bf64b632b3c..2b6df5fee5a380fa500485a2c6ab5f04bf6395f3 100644 (file)
@@ -19,7 +19,7 @@
  
   In this module, the Earth is assumed to be perfectly spherical.
   (If that's too inaccurate for you, you might want to look at the
-  PostGIS
+  s://postgis.net/">PostGIS
   project.)
  
 
index d0a1ef3fb9e6f1dacf621784392c6d935cbed0a1..9f8fe86630567db9f346f3118db56dd2af4fa737 100644 (file)
@@ -79,7 +79,7 @@
       libpqxx
       C++
       C++ interface
-      
+      s://pqxx.org/">
      
 
      
@@ -93,7 +93,7 @@
       Npgsql
       .NET
       .NET data provider
-      
+      s://www.npgsql.org/">
      
 
      
       psycopg
       Python
       DB API 2.0-compliant
-      ://initd.org/psycopg/">
+      s://www.psycopg.org/">
      
     
    
    contains several extensions, which are described in
    .  Other extensions are developed
    independently, like 
-   url="http://postgis.net/">PostGIS.  Even
+   url="https://postgis.net/">PostGIS.  Even
    PostgreSQL replication solutions can be developed
    externally. For example,  
-   url="http://www.slony.info">Slony-I is a popular
+   url="https://www.slony.info">Slony-I is a popular
    master/standby replication solution that is developed independently
    from the core project.
   
index 38a3ad0cd8b698a13383c6bd35057ff55b5fced5..25cc3e47f280e0035f091429abd6317107409fe5 100644 (file)
 
     
      
-      
+      s://www.red3d.com/cwr/evolve.html">
       Evolutionary Computation and its application to art and design, by
       Craig Reynolds
      
index 04b55cfadf493bee626cc37b61c9f083d74a20f2..fbe69cac721fd54a32ebe142cf64a5f27f7f955f 100644 (file)
@@ -278,7 +278,7 @@ $ENV{MSBFLAGS}="/m";
      
       Required for GSSAPI authentication support. MIT Kerberos can be
       downloaded from
-      .
+      s://web.mit.edu/Kerberos/dist/index.html">.
      
     
 
@@ -287,7 +287,7 @@ $ENV{MSBFLAGS}="/m";
       libxslt
      
       Required for XML support. Binaries can be downloaded from
-       or source from
+      s://zlatkovic.com/pub/libxml"> or source from
       . Note that libxml2 requires iconv,
       which is available from the same download location.
      
@@ -324,7 +324,7 @@ $ENV{MSBFLAGS}="/m";
      
       Required for compression support in pg_dump
       and pg_restore. Binaries can be downloaded
-      from .
+      from s://www.zlib.net">.
      
     
 
index f0dba6f56fb487f2cc4ba110c3c8318bc3aadabe..ad7778599e0747b1f2e3bec912a139bad33660bf 100644 (file)
@@ -87,7 +87,7 @@
   
    PostgreSQL is an object-relational
    database management system (ORDBMS) based on
-   ://db.cs.berkeley.edu/postgres.html">
+   s://dsf.berkeley.edu/postgres.html">
    POSTGRES, Version 4.2,
    developed at the University of California at Berkeley Computer Science
    Department.  POSTGRES pioneered many concepts that only became
index c1da702df63ca226d041dbde1cd025297f97c9e1..97d1f79a3ad8a46e603cae7dd077498010a7b383 100644 (file)
@@ -355,10 +355,10 @@ SELECT isbn13(id) FROM test;
    The information to implement this module was collected from
    several sites, including:
    
-    
-    
-    
-    
+    s://www.isbn-international.org/">
+    s://www.issn.org/">
+    s://www.ismn-international.org/">
+    s://www.wikipedia.org/">
    
 
    The prefixes used for hyphenation were also compiled from:
index d1582e0b9ed97856cd17380a1047fa9047456b5c..c492114f331f925e54c1d077e0162992f729b494 100644 (file)
@@ -3469,7 +3469,7 @@ SELECT pg_stat_get_backend_pid(s.backendid) AS pid,
    DTrace
    utility is supported, which, at the time of this writing, is available
    on Solaris, macOS, FreeBSD, NetBSD, and Oracle Linux.  The
-   SystemTap project
+   s://sourceware.org/systemtap/">SystemTap project
    for Linux provides a DTrace equivalent and can also be used.  Supporting other dynamic
    tracing utilities is theoretically possible by changing the definitions for
    the macros in src/include/utils/probes.h.
index 1d331473af3ce64116e8b13648867e9ea1adaafb..a095a1907f914cf46f794318f45360b6cb6e1185 100644 (file)
@@ -146,7 +146,7 @@ msgstr "another translated"
     someone has already done some translation work.  The files are
     named language.po,
     where language is the
-    
+    s://www.loc.gov/standards/iso639-2/php/English_list.php">
     ISO 639-1 two-letter language code (in lower case), e.g.,
     fr.po for French.  If there is really a need
     for more than one translation effort per language then the files
index f3477dc22330053f93303e171d5f07c2f6b224e8..b4cd8ebc1971857bf129d8a1089bae7c166f41a2 100644 (file)
@@ -1290,12 +1290,12 @@ gen_random_uuid() returns uuid
      The GNU Privacy Handbook.
     
     
-     
+     s://www.openwall.com/crypt/">
      Describes the crypt-blowfish algorithm.
     
     
      
-      ://www.stack.nl/~galactus/remailers/passphrase-faq.html">
+      s://www.iusmentis.com/security/passphrasefaq/">
      
      How to choose a good password.
     
@@ -1341,7 +1341,7 @@ gen_random_uuid() returns uuid
      Description of Fortuna CSPRNG.
     
     
-     
+     s://jlcooke.ca/random/">
      Jean-Luc Cooke Fortuna-based /dev/random driver for Linux.
     
    
index 37a3557d61227be15d4cf3c9d870b9f1e4bf05d4..3451cdafb3df84de671462102d6d82d4d837f5ea 100644 (file)
@@ -14,7 +14,7 @@
   
    PL/Perl is a loadable procedural language that enables you to write
    PostgreSQL functions in the
-   Perl programming language.
+   s://www.perl.org">Perl programming language.
   
 
   
index acd4dd69d3ee64309b1756f1d3c233c0c545a86d..23af32583a5c8cf849cce70dded3a9dc2d603d11 100644 (file)
@@ -14,7 +14,7 @@
   
    PL/Tcl is a loadable procedural language for the
    PostgreSQL database system
-   that enables the 
+   that enables the s://www.tcl.tk/">
    Tcl language to be used to write functions and
    trigger procedures.
   
index 5d1f546b536791920cf7d8ecbc0342c1fd3f880a..0df412da29361a801c46eff2e2d5ea67419f621f 100644 (file)
@@ -384,7 +384,7 @@ postgres=> select '10(+-)1'::seg as seg;
 
   
    My thanks are primarily to Prof. Joe Hellerstein
-   (://db.cs.berkeley.edu/jmh/">) for elucidating the
+   (s://dsf.berkeley.edu/jmh/">) for elucidating the
    gist of the GiST (). I am
    also grateful to all Postgres developers, present and past, for enabling
    myself to create my own world and live undisturbed in it. And I would like
index f8c61b937946c2ee7e8db66c59f88a8852d52e2d..ca1e72dd89c294fd053672555fa4438e2e33a2bc 100644 (file)
@@ -3009,7 +3009,7 @@ largehearted
     The Snowball dictionary template is based on a project
     by Martin Porter, inventor of the popular Porter's stemming algorithm
     for the English language.  Snowball now provides stemming algorithms for
-    many languages (see the Snowball
+    many languages (see the s://snowballstem.org/">Snowball
     site for more information).  Each algorithm understands how to
     reduce common variant forms of words to a base, or stem, spelling within
     its language.  A Snowball dictionary requires a language